java实战项目推荐(javaweb实战项目大全)

Java实战项目推荐

在学习Java编程过程中,除了基础语法的学习,更好的提升编程能力和项目实战能够实现对知识的深度理解和掌握。以下是推荐的几个Java实战项目,希望对编程初学者有所帮助。

在线商城项目

经典的线上商城项目,适合Java Web初学者练手,提供了完整的电商应用流程,包括用户注册、商品展示、购物车管理、订单管理等功能。项目难度较低,可用于巩固Java Web基础,熟悉常用框架Spring、SpringMVC和MyBatis的使用,更好的理解MVC架构模式。

java实战项目推荐(javaweb实战项目大全)

在线商城项目的实现需要运用HTML、CSS、JavaScript等前端技术,结合后端的Java工具和框架,实现对数据库的增删改查,对商品展示的美化和用户的购买体验的完善,这些都是团队合作和项目开发所必要的能力。

小型社交网络

社交网络是最广泛应用的一类网站,相关知识点涉及到Web开发的前后端技术、数据结构与算法等。小型社交网络项目的功能相对简单,在交友、聊天、发帖等模块上开发,使用Spring、SpringMVC、MyBatis、Hibernate等Java工具和技术,结合neo4j、ElasticSearch、HBase等数据库技术,能更好地学习Java Web应用的开发和设计。

小型社交网络的开发需要理解Web应用的架构,如何通过后端服务实现前端的需求,以及如何使用数据库来优化应用性能。同时,也需要了解一些常用的机器学习和数据挖掘算法,以实现社交网络自动推荐、贴标签等高级功能。

物流管理系统

物流管理系统是一类较为实用的系统,与大多数人的工作生活都有关系。该系统主要涵盖了物流信息管理、仓库管理、配货管理、送货管理等领域,旨在为用户提供便捷的物流信息查询和实时的物流跟踪服务。

物流管理系统需要熟悉Java语言、Spring、SpringMVC、MyBatis等框架技术,以及Tomcat、Maven、Git等常用工具的使用。同时,还涉及到大量的数据存储和数据处理,这需要专业的数据库技术和数据结构与算法知识的掌握。物流管理系统的开发过程中,需要注重系统的可维护性和可扩展性,以提高系统的可靠性和稳定性,更好地为用户提供优质的服务体验。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/java958.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年4月24日 下午7:40
下一篇 2023年4月24日 下午7:40

猜你喜欢